The detector circuit is responsible for converting the amplified RF signal into an audible or visual signal that can be interpreted by the user. This can be accomplished using a simple diode detector circuit, which rectifies the RF signal and produces a DC voltage proportional to the signal strength. The diodes may be small signal germanium or silicon although Schottly diodes are preferred. Assemble the components on a small piece of printed circuit board. Use wire probes or a BNC coax socket at the RF input with very short leads to the PCB.
